US City Branding
In the US City Branding project, the goal was to establish a brand guide for a city. I chose to create a brand for San Francisco, CA. Instead of using the Golden Gate Bridge for my logo, I decided to showcase Chinatown. With the Chinese American population being the largest single-minority in the city, I felt their impact to the city is important. I created a combination logo with the glyph being a Chinese lantern. The colors are multi-faceted. Red is a color of good luck in Chinese culture, and it is the color of the Golden Gate Bridge. Gold/yellow is a color of wealth, and San Francisco was born due to the Gold Rush of 1849. The typeface I chose for the logo is angular and hilly similar to the streets of San Francisco.
